Eo gdb: Implement eo_data_get to get eo data.
Like
79d76fb25ece4ffbf5785b4be2b030f062ef9f2c, this is useful when
debugging a core dump.
It accepts a valid pointer to an object, for example as returned from
$eo_resolve, and a name of a class or mixin, and returns a pointer to
the private data. Essentially the same as efl_data_scope_get(), but also
works on core dumps, and accepts a class name instead of a class
pointer.
Usage:
Print the pointer:
(gdb) print $eo_data_get($eo_resolve(obj), "Efl_Canvas_Object")
$1 = (void *) 0x555555eb9290
Use it directly (e.g. to print a value):
(gdb) print ((Evas_Object_Protected_Data *) $eo_data_get($eo_resolve(obj),
"Efl_Canvas_Object"))->last_event_type
$2 = EVAS_CALLBACK_MOUSE_UP
